Description

Tasks: * Remove the assignee of a task using cmd-ctrl-r * Assign the time of a task with ctrl-t Task List: When you mark a task complete using cmd-enter in the task list view, Shortcuts for Asana will return your focus to the first open task. Search Results: ctrl-r will click the 'Refine search' button. Task Description: If you have links within a task description, Shortcuts for Asana adds keyboard shortcuts for those tasks: * cmd-ctrl-1: open the first link in a new tab * cmd-ctrl-2...: etc Dependent Task Dialog: If you mark a task done which has dependent tasks, links to those tasks appear in the warning dialog. Shortcuts for Asana adds keyboard shortcuts for those tasks: * cmd-ctrl-1: click on first task in the dependent task warning dialog. * cmd-ctrl-2...: etc * cmd-enter: mark the original task as complete and close the dialog.
